Togni-II Reagent Mediated Selective Hydrotrifluoromethylation and Hydrothiolation of Alkenes?

Based on the redox reactions of Togni-II reagent and thiols, a thiol-tuned selective functionalization of unactivated olefins was disclosed. In combination with aryl thiols, stoichiometric amount of Togni-II reagent prompted a hydrotrifluoromethylation of alkenes, in which, aryl thiols played as reductant and hydrogen source; while by utilization of alkyl thiols, catalytic amount of Togni-II reagent initiated thiol-ene and thiol-yne reactions. The reported applications are characterized by their operational simplicity and wide functional group tolerance.
Gold(I)-catalyzed glycosidation of 1,2-anhydrosugars

(Chemical Equation Presented) Being able to increase the yield by >20% compared to the conventional use of anhydrous zinc chloride (>1 equiv) as a promoter, Ph3PAuOTf is disclosed to be a superior catalyst for the well-established glycosylation reaction with 1,2-anhydrosugars as donors.
